Guan Ju's slightly "sudden" run out of a piece of data, which suddenly made Ding Sheng sleepy, and even with all the work in the plan, he had to slow down temporarily.
The whole new base also fell into tranquility with the contemplation of the owner.
"How's that, do you have any ideas?"
A few hours later, Guan Ju broke the silence, and if it weren't for Ding Sheng's brain being active all the time, Guan Ju would have thought he was asleep.
In fact, in the past few hours, Ding Sheng's thoughts have been pulled back to 2015 in the Marvel world for most of the time.
That year, after many years of moving to San Francisco, he had his first "business dealings" with a company called Pym Technology.
"This data is really critical for me, it's a big breakthrough, and it may take me a long time to sort out this information, and you can help me deal with incidents below the S level as appropriate. ”
As early as the first day of the quantum computer's formation, Ding Sheng handed over an important task to Guan Ju, that is, the "Pym particle" formula.
As a copycat-born inventor, Ding Sheng's Pym particle formula is not mature, and he has been working to perfect this set of formulas for nearly three years from the second half of 2015 to his return in 2018, but he has not succeeded.
Although Ding Sheng's attainments in quantum technology have reached a very high level, and he can even build a quantum tunnel prototype by himself, the matter of Pym particles has always been a problem for him.
In the end, it only brought back a set of broken formulas.
Although the quantum tunnel and the Pym particle are both created by Dr. Hank, there is no direct relationship between the two.
So it's not surprising that Ding Sheng can bypass the Pym particle to study quantum tunneling.
Now that quantum tunneling has been developed, the main thing here is the Pym particle.
I believe many people know that matter is nothing more than a bunch of atoms.
In the final analysis, people and fish in the water, birds in the sky, and stones on the street are all of the same root.
In quantum physics, there is some basic common sense, such as that an atom is made up of a nucleus and electrons surrounding it.
The blank part between the electron and the nucleus is all air, which occupies almost 9999 of the space inside the atom.
This means that the inside of the atom is empty.
So, Hank Pym put forward a hypothesis about whether atoms can be compressed
From the point of view of a normal person or an ordinary physicist, of course not.
The reason is simple, and it involves another common sense, which our world calls the Pauli Incompatibility Principle.
To put it simply, electrons are not allowed to exist in the same position at the same time, and a sufficient safety distance must be maintained between them.
Hank Pym is not an ordinary person, nor is he an ordinary physicist, but also a super stubborn temper, he simply relies on his unparalleled talent and knowledge to create a subatomic called the "Pym particle", which can ignore Pauli's incompatibility and arbitrarily change the distance between electrons and nuclei.
Pym particles can scale atoms down arbitrarily, while any matter is made up of atoms, which means that all matter can be scaled up and down by Pym particles.
Then, Ant-Man was born.
However, whether an atom expands or compresses, it becomes the distance between the nucleus and the electron, and the weight of the atom is mainly concentrated in the nucleus and electron, so according to the law of conservation of mass, the mass should always remain the same whether it becomes larger or smaller.
This is also one of the main reasons why even in Marvel, Pym particles can be used as a top black technology.
In other words, it's anti-physics.
And Ding Sheng, after all, is not Hank Pim.
There is a certain gap between his talent in Pym particles and Dr. Hank, and he is probably at the same level as Dr. Hank's former disciple, the well-known villain Darren Krauss.
After obtaining part of the Pym particle formula, Ding Sheng spent three years without completely solving one problem, that is, the conservation of mass.
When he was in the Marvel world, Ding Sheng's self-made version of the original Pym particles could simply shrink and enlarge some household appliances such as sofas, dining tables, and rice cookers, but no matter how the volume changed, the quality did not change.
It hurts.
You must know that Ant-Man can fly on ants, and if the volume becomes smaller and the mass remains the same, how can the ants carry him.
On the contrary, if Ant-Man only weighs more than 100 pounds after becoming bigger during the civil war, in the face of the Iron Man camp, his fluttering body will be beaten in addition to being beaten.
Therefore, Ding Sheng can conclude that Hank Pym's version of the Pym particle has a way to increase and decrease the mass with the change of volume.
It's just that I didn't find the right way.
As a plagiarism maniac, it was impossible for Ding Sheng to ask Dr. Hank directly, so it was delayed until he returned, and the focus of his work shifted, and he temporarily threw this matter to Guan Ju.
Guan Ju's method of perfecting the formula is very simple and crude, that is, to run through all possible situations.
The advantage of this stupid method is that as long as it lasts for a long time, it will one day be able to run the result, and the disadvantage is obvious, it takes too long.
But I can't stand the luck, the formula that would have taken many years to perfect, just a few hours ago, by chance, the first breakthrough was met.
This breakthrough showed Ding Sheng the possibility that mass could not be conserved.
"Maybe that's the difference between me and Mr. Stark, Dr. Hank, and Dr. Banner, and I should have thought that the Pym particle didn't violate the law of conservation of mass, but cheated. "The gap in talent, Ding Sheng has always been willing to admit it.
"But you're more well-rounded and younger than them, and the future will always be yours. For Guan Ju, Ding Sheng, who created it, is undoubtedly perfect, "Moreover, there is no competition between you and them, it is more like the inheritance of another world." ”
I have to say that Guan Ju explained the "trans-multiverse copycat" very reasonably.
"Okay, I'm thinking about where to start next"
The data that Guan Ju ran out this time, after several hours of argumentation by Ding Sheng, pointed out that on the problem of the conservation of mass of the Pym particle, Dr. Hank is very likely to cheat with the help of "multi-dimensional pockets".
That is to say, when the matter becomes larger and smaller under the influence of the Pym particles, the Pym particles open a multi-dimensional pocket, which can transfer the excess or missing mass into it, and then act as a transit station, and then transfer it back when the matter returns to its original state.
It is commonly known as more refund and less compensation.
And in that dimension of this multi-dimensional pocket is a problem that Ding Sheng needs to demonstrate and solve now.
Perhaps in the end this direction is simply wrong, and Dr. Hank may have a more powerful way to solve the problem of conservation of mass, but at this point, he has an "almost doable" path in front of him.
As an inventor, as every day in the Marvel world, Ding Sheng needs to explore and finally get a result.
The road is long, I will go up and down and seek.
"Let's start with the Kara Picchu Space. ”
As we all know, the space we live in is a four-dimensional space composed of x, y, z, and time, plus a dimension on the unity of the hierarchy, which is the fifth dimension.
The Kara Picchu Chengtong space is a theoretical typical six-dimensional space, and it is also a curled up high-dimensional space. This was originally a conjecture put forward by Calabi at the 1954 International Mathematical Congress, and later Yau Chengtong proved this conjecture, hence the name of the "Kachu" space.
The proof of this great conjecture directly brought geometry into a whole new field, and it shines brightly in many aspects of physics.
The reason why Ding Sheng regards this space as the first choice to carry the mass transfer station of Pym particles is because this space has been proven whether it is in this world or in the Marvel world, and the fluctuation equation and tightening performance derived from it are more or less in line with the requirements of the transfer station.
"A month, if a month's time, if I can't prove that the Kachu space is the multi-dimensional pocket transit station, I'll put the matter of Pym particles on hold for the time being. ”
The plan can't catch up with the changes, but Ding Sheng also understands the truth that everything can't be ambitious.
Pym particles are good, but hard.
You know, even if the problem of conservation of mass is solved, the Ding liter version of the Pym particle still has problems such as the incongruity and asynchronous local size of the living body that needs to be solved, and there is still a long way to go to make it bigger and smaller like Ant-Man.
Before that, if you really face a crisis, the steel armor is the most reliable.
So this month can be regarded as an explanation from Ding Sheng to himself.
Retreat, begin.
Pasadena, California.
After graduating, Noah still came to this small city with an academic atmosphere every year.
The city is best known for being home to the world's top private research university, the California Institute of Technology, and home to the protagonists of the Big Bang Theory.
Drive all the way to a remote private laboratory on the outskirts of the city.
In the front yard of the laboratory, there were more than a dozen people standing, chatting and laughing.
In Noah's memory, this was the busiest time since the establishment of this laboratory.
Soon, he found the hostess of this laboratory in the courtyard, the heroine of today's academic exchange meeting.
"Congratulations, Catherine. ”
"Noah, I didn't expect you to come too, thank you very much. ”
In 2009, when Catherine Oxton became a private laboratory, she received a strong sponsorship from Noah Ellington.
Catherine Labs can become the world's most luxurious and top private laboratory, and Lingxiao Group has contributed a lot.
Although this is due to Noah's opening of the sky, but aside from this relationship, Noah is also one of the few classmates of Catherine who can keep up with her thinking speed when she was a student, and the two still have a good relationship during school.
"It is an honour to witness the youngest member of the Academy of Sciences in history. Noah said, handing over the flowers in his hand.
After the completion of the Chinese Quantum Entanglement Project, the American Congressional Committee, the National Research Council, and the Tube Committee officially awarded Katherine Oxton the honor of Academician.
He is also the youngest academician since President Abraham Lincoln signed an act establishing the National Academy of Sciences in 1863.
At the same time, Noah can also be very responsible to say that this record will not be broken for a long time in the future.
"Hello, Mr. Williams. ”
After a brief conversation with Catherine, Noah saw another acquaintance, who had been a graduate student under Academician Williams for a time during his college years, and the two had maintained a friendly teacher-student relationship for many years.
Noah Ellington, who is over 100 years old, still has enough experience in managing contacts.
As a colleague of Catherine in the quantum entanglement project, Academician Williams' presence here today is simply not too reasonable.
In this way, it saved Noah a lot of trouble, "Since the teacher is also here, I don't have to go to the Academy of Sciences to find you." ”
He came to the United States this time because he had two things to do.
The first thing, naturally, is to see what Catherine is doing best, she is directly related to the issue of Noah's ticket home.
Since Catherine and Academician Williams are here, it is convenient.
"Then I'll talk about business first. ”
Noah took out a delicate USB flash drive from his arms, and Catherine on the side was about to withdraw when she saw this, but was stopped by Noah, "It's okay, Catherine, you don't have to go, so do you."
